Basic Information

Item Detail
Product Name 1-[4-Amino-7-(3-Hydroxypropyl)-5-(4-Methylphenyl)-7H-Pyrrolo[2,3-D]Pyrimidin-6-Yl]-2-Fluoroethanone
CAS No. 821794-92-7
Molecular Formula C18H19FN4O2
Molecular Weight 342.37 g/mol
Synonyms 2-Fluoro-1-[4-amino-7-(3-hydroxypropyl)-5-(4-methylphenyl)pyrrolo[2,3-d]pyrimidin-6-yl]ethanone; 1-[4-Amino-7-(3-hydroxypropyl)-5-p-tolyl-7H-pyrrolo[2,3-d]pyrimidin-6-yl]-2-fluoroethanone; 821794-92-7; 6-Acetyl-4-amino-7-(3-hydroxypropyl)-5-(4-methylphenyl)-7H-pyrrolo[2,3-d]pyrimidine-2-fluoro derivative

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(typically 15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ed in a dry environment to prevent degradation. Long-term storage under an inert atmosphere (e.g., nitrogen or argon) is recommended for optimal stability.
